AN ACT
To amend title 49, United States Code, to direct the Assistant
Secretary of Homeland Security (Transportation Security Administration)
to transfer unclaimed clothing recovered at airport security
checkpoints to local veterans organizations and other local charitable
organizations, and for other purposes.
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ives of the
United States of America in Congress assembled,
SECTION 1. SHORT TITLE.
This Act may be cited as the ``Clothe a Homeless Hero Act''.
SEC. 2. DISPOSITION OF UNCLAIMED CLOTHING RECOVERED AT AIRPORT SECURITY
CHECKPOINTS.
(a) In General.--Section 44945 of title 49, United States Code, is
amended--
(1) in the section heading, by inserting ``and clothing''
after ``money'';
(2) by inserting before the text the following: ``(a)
Disposition of Unclaimed Money.--''; and
(3) by adding at the end the following:
``(b) Disposition of Unclaimed Clothing.--
``(1) In general.--In disposing of unclaimed clothing
recovered at any airport security checkpoint, the Assistant
Secretary shall make every reasonable effort, in consultation
with the Secretary of Veterans Affairs, to transfer the
clothing to local veterans organizations or other local
charitable organizations for distribution to homeless or needy
veterans and veteran families.
``(2) Agreements.--In implementing paragraph (1), the
Assistant Secretary may enter into agreements with airport
authorities.
``(3) Other charitable arrangements.--Nothing in this
subsection shall prevent an airport or the Transportation
Security Administration from donating unclaimed clothing to a
charitable organization of their choosing.
``(4) Limitation.--Nothing in this subsection shall create
a cost to the Government.''.
